Troubleshooting

SymptomPossible CauseCorrective Action
Dryer not startingPower supply issueCheck power cord and outlet.
No heatHeating element failureInspect and replace heating element if necessary.
Clothes not dryingOverloading or vent blockageReduce load size and check vent for blockages.
Unusual noiseForeign object in drumInspect drum for foreign objects and remove.
